逆行输尿管镜下气压弹道碎石术治疗输尿管大结石

摘    要:目的 探讨逆行输尿管镜下气压弹道碎石术治疗输尿管大结石的安全性与有效性.方法 自2000年1月至2005年10月采用逆行输尿管镜下气压弹道碎石术治疗输尿管大结石68例,其中11例此前经过体外震波碎石未成功.男42例,女26例,年龄21~69岁,平均44岁.输尿管上段结石59例,中段7例,下段2例.结石直径2.0~4.4 cm,平均2.4cm.结果 68例输尿管结石一次彻底清除率89.7%(61例).2例结石上移至肾盂未完成手术;5例术后出现输尿管结石粉末残留,其中2例术后4周行静脉肾盂造影复查发现结石已排空,2例经过再次逆行输尿管镜下气压弹道碎石术彻底清除,1例经过输尿管切开取石清除.68例均未出现输尿管穿孔、输尿管狭窄等并发症.结论 逆行输尿管镜下气压弹道碎石术治疗输尿管结石安全、清除彻底、并发症少,可作为治疗输尿管大结石的首选.

Pneumatic Lithotripsy through Retrograde Ureteroscope for Treatment of Large Ureteral Calculi

Abstract:Objective To investigate the safety and efficacy of pneumatic lithotripsy through retrograde ureteroscope as the treatment for large ureteral stones. Methods From January 2000 to October 2005, we performed pneumatic lithotripsy through retrograde ureteroscope in 68 patients (42 men, 26 women, age range 21~69 years, mean age 44 years) with large ureteral stones more than 2 cm in size. Of the 68 stones, 59 were located in the lower ureter, 7 were in the middle ureter, and 2 were located in the lower ureter. The mean stone diameter was 2.4 cm (range 2.0~4.4 cm), Of the 68 patients, 11 had stones that could not be effectively fragmented by shock wave lithotripsy (ESWL) previously. Results Of the 68 stones, 61 (89.7%) were removed completely by a single pneumatic lithotripsy through retrograde ureteroscope. The operation failed in 2 cases due to shift of the stone to the renal pelvis. 5 cases had residual fragments in the ureter, 2 could not be found on IVU 4 weeks after operation, 2 were removed completely by second pneumatic lithotripsy through retrograde ureteroscope, 1 was cleared completely by open surgery. None of 68 patients had complications of perforation or ureteral stricture. Conclusion Pneumatic lithotripsy through retrograde ureteroscope is a safe and effective technique with less complications and complete clearance of the calculi. It can be a first-line therapy for large ureteral stones.
